Development of a prototype handmade water filter / Muhammad Danish Fathullah Mohamad Zaidy

Mohamad Zaidy, Muhammad Danish Fathullah (2024) Development of a prototype handmade water filter / Muhammad Danish Fathullah Mohamad Zaidy. [Student Project] (Unpublished)

Abstract

This project aims for people with low budgets to be able obtain a good water filter without using a lot of cost. The objectives of this project are to design and fabricate a low-cost water filter within a budget of RM250, which is more convenient for most people. There are a lot of existing products which are most of them are not relevant and overpriced. By utilizing most of the components such as UV lights, pump and advanced design principles, the prototype handmade water filter fills with a promising result which is having clean water to use for cooking and drinking. The project will employ a design-based approach, encompassing research, conceptualization, prototyping, and testing. The project also gives a clean water and safe for consumers to consume the water. The water dispenser also having a complex route for the clean water to flow, but after it revised and testing, the outcome of the filters are unexpectedly good.
